Pedagogical Pleasures Lee Garfinkel The peace agreements that broughtPedagogical Pleasures inquires into pleasure (understood as enjoyment, delight, and or gratification) as a crucial but neglected aspect of teachers' lives and work. Pleasure is examined as an historically contingent and unstable product of language use, rather than as a spontaneous, personal, and psychologicalfeeling. This book is a departure from conventional accounts of pedagogy in two ways : It is unashamedly about teachers rather than students ,
